6 elektromagnetisches Feld
электромагнитное поле
Вид материи, определяемый во всех точках двумя векторными величинами, которые характеризуют две его стороны, называемые «электрическое поле» и «магнитное поле», оказывающий силовое воздействие на электрически заряженные частицы, зависящее от их скорости и электрического заряда.
[ ГОСТ Р 52002-2003]EN
electromagnetic field
field, determined by a set of four interrelated vector quantities, that characterizes, together with the electric current density and the volumic electric charge, the electric and magnetic conditions of a material medium or of vacuum
NOTE 1 – The four interrelated vector quantities, which obey Maxwell equations, are by convention:
– the electric field strength E,
– the electric flux density D,
– the magnetic field strength H,
– the magnetic flux density B.
NOTE 2 – This definition of electromagnetic field is valid in so far as certain quantum aspects of electromagnetic phenomena can be neglected.
Source: from 705-01-07
[IEV number 121-11-61]FR

10 abgeleitete Einheit
производная единица системы единиц физических величин
производная единица
Единица производной физической величины системы единиц, образованная в соответствии с уравнением, связывающим ее с основными единицами или с основными и уже определенными производными.
Примеры
1. 1 м/с - единица скорости, образованная из основных единиц СИ - метра и секунды.
2. 1 Н - единица силы, образованная из основных единиц СИ - килограмма, метра, и секунды.
[РМГ 29-99]EN
derived unit
unit of measurement for a derived quantity
NOTE 1 – Some derived units in the International System of Units (SI) have special names, e.g. hertz for frequency and joule for energy, but others have compound names, e.g. metre per second for speed. Compounds including units with special names are also used, e.g. volt per metre for the electric field strength, and newton metre for torque. See in particular ISO 31 and ISO/IEC 80000.
NOTE 2 – Derived units can also be expressed by using multiples and submultiples. For example, the metre per second, symbol m/s, and the centimetre per second, symbol cm/s, are derived units of speed in the SI. The kilometre per hour, symbol km/h, is a unit of speed outside the SI but accepted for use with the SI, because the unit hour is accepted for use with the SI. The knot, equal to one nautical mile per hour, is a unit of speed outside the SI, that is used by special interest groups.
Source: ISO/IEC GUIDE 99:2007 1.11

19 Meereskreislauf
циркуляция морской воды
—
[ http://www.eionet.europa.eu/gemet/alphabetic?langcode=en]EN
sea circulation
Large-scale horizontal water motion within an ocean. The way energy from the sun, stored in the sea, is transported around the world. The currents explain, for example, why the UK has ice-free ports in winter, while St. Petersburg, at the same latitude as the Shetland Islands, needs ice breakers. Evidence is growing that the world's ocean circulation was very different during the last ice age and has changed several times in the distant past, with dramatic effects on climate. The oceans are vital as storehouses, as they absorb more than half the sun's heat reaching the earth. This heat, which is primarily absorbed near the equator is carried around the world and released elsewhere, creating currents which last up to 1.000 years. As the Earth rotates and the wind acts upon the surface, currents carry warm tropical water to the cooler parts of the world. The strength and direction of the currents are affected by landmasses, bottlenecks through narrow straits, and even the shape of the sea-bed. When the warm water reaches polar regions its heat evaporates into the atmosphere, reducing its temperature and increasing its density. When sea-water freezes it leaves salt behind in the unfrozen water and this cold water sinks into the ocean and begins to flow back to the tropics. Eventually it is heated and begins the cycle all over again. (Source: MGH / WRIGHT)
